8. 55 ml of a solution containing 0.2 mol/l Ca(NO3)2 and 0.95 g of crystalline oxalic acid were added to 55 ml of a solution containing 1*10-5 mol/l of thorium salt. Find the degree of coprecipitation and the residual concentrations of thorium and calcium in the solution. PR(Th(C2O4)2)=5*10-25, PR(CaC2O4)=2*10-9. Was quantitative coprecipitation of thorium achieved, >99% sufficient for analysis?
